You’ll be testing the integrity of critical component parts of aircraft
Using digital x-ray devices to ensure there are no cracks, flaws or fractures, this naturally requires your absolute attention to detail
Other tasks include undertaking helium gas leak detection and penetrating dye inspection of machined components
You need Level 1, Level 2 or Level 3 NAS410 or EN 4179 or equivalent, experience in NDT quality control and inspection, preferably in the aerospace, automotive, nuclear, rail or medical device engineering sector including the analysis of film or digital x-ray images.
